Molinari: Donovan is ‘going to run’

Colby Hamilton

Daniel Donovan, Staten Island’s district attorney, has already decided to run in the special election to replace Rep. Michael Grimm, according to Guy Molinari, the influential Staten Island Republican and former borough president.

Donovan, a former chief of staff to Molinari, issued a statement earlier on Tuesday that said he is "seriously considering" a run.

Molinari said he’d spoken with Donovan directly, and that the D.A. had informed Molinari of his decision.
